SCHEDULE 5ENFORCEMENT

General duties of enforcement authorities

1

Except as specified in paragraph 3, it shall be the duty of the Health and Safety Executive to make adequate arrangements for the enforcement of these Regulations in Great Britain in relation to machinery and partly completed machinery for use at work.

2

Except as specified in paragraph 3, it shall be the duty of every local weights and measures authority in Great Britain to enforce these Regulations within its area in relation to machinery or partly completed machinery which is not for use at work.

3

It shall be the duty of the Office of Rail Regulation to make adequate arrangements for the enforcement of these Regulations in Great Britain where the Health and Safety (Enforcing Authority for Railways and Other Guided Transport Systems) Regulations 2006 make it the enforcing authority, within the meaning of section 18(7) of the 1974 Act, in relation to machinery or partly completed machinery for use in the operation of a railway, tramway or any other system of guided transport, as defined in those Regulations.

4

It shall be the duty of the Health and Safety Executive for Northern Ireland to make adequate arrangements for the enforcement of these Regulations in Northern Ireland in relation to machinery and partly completed machinery for use at work.

5

It shall be the duty of every district council in Northern Ireland to enforce these Regulations within its area in relation to machinery or partly completed machinery which is not for use at work.

6

The Secretary of State may enforce these Regulations in relation to machinery or partly completed machinery which is not for use at work in cases where the Office of Rail Regulation is not the enforcement authority.
